Eight Living Legs played in the Auckland alternative scene from 1981 - 1983. They were a band who impressed many that saw them perform in those years, including musician Mark Webster who describes them as "...engaging, consummate musicians, tight as all hell, professional yet with a quirky, stroppy humour that came across live...Eight Living Legs was a band that should have made it..." The band's only release was back in 1983 where they shared vinyl space with another Auckland band Flak.
